Chapter three: Chains (Flash fiction)

"Nolsten reports. He's here", I say into the phone, and my interlocutor immediately turns down.

We might just now have one year of peace. It is him, the Savior's student. His back is slightly curved, he doesn't look strong at all. What else is strange is his whole body is covered with cloth. His face- scarfed, his master's mask placed on top of his head. He wears black gloves, and up to knee boots, a soldier uniform and a single shoulderplate.

Emperor Mordecai stands up, furious, looking up to the man slowly descending, levitating towards the center of the arena. Everyone holds their breaths in anticipation.

One of the killer demons takes action, carrying one-handed sword made of sand-colored crystal.

"Get out of here. It is too late to sign in now. Wait for the next year, mortal."

The Scarf-man finally touches the ground. Then he dissapears. Then he appears behind the Killer demon, his fist impaling through his stomach.

The demon spits dark-blue blood and then he dissolves together with his weapon into the ground.

Champions of humanity look like puppies next to the Scarf-man. Emperor and the remaining Killer, as well as greenskinned demon and even Doctor Steelarm all enter the arena.

Scarf-man kneels down. Finally, the ground opens and red-glowing chains from hell emerge, pressing the demon company helpless. The Mordecai looks frightened.

I have witnessed something great, though I have no idea exactly what.

"One year of freedom", he says, then he vanished to nothingness.
